Output 145dbd2ed71822b6331ce3054f942654b48d5d4450da09bb98af1e7e1502e068:3

value
26540936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d8eb64ce67e5c1362537a84cacbb23a1bcaee8 OP_EQUAL
address
MBMH6MoYvvTcH9qLtCK61i81ccg1UaumNN
transaction
145dbd2ed71822b6331ce3054f942654b48d5d4450da09bb98af1e7e1502e068
spent
true